The Chestnut Hill College Men's Tennis team closed out their regular season and clinched home court advantage throughout the playoffs as they defeated Dominican University 5-2 Friday afternoon at Manny Welder Park in Monsey, New York.
The Griffins finish the regular season at 13-8 overall and 5-4 in Central Atlantic Collegiate conference matches and a second place finish behind defending champion Thomas Jefferson University (9-0 CACC). The Chargers finish their season at 1-11 overall and 0-9 in league play.
With home court secured, Chestnut Hill will host Post University on Tuesday, April 18, 2023, at the CHC Tennis courts. First serve will be at 2:00 p.m.
The Griffins jumped out to a 1-0 lead in the match by winning two of the three doubles contests to secure the doubles points.Â
Tom Pitchley and
Noah Cutting defeated Qalib Ladhani and John Bruno  6-2 at #1 doubles and
Marcello Bozzone and
Pedro Vicente were 6-3 victors over Skyler ross and Ander Sadaba at #3 doubles.
The Chargers tied the match at 1-1 as Marcos Lee defeated
Tiago Lima at #1 singles 6-2, 6-2. Pitchley put the Griffins ahead again with a 6-4, 6-2 victory over Guilherme Salim at #2 singles. Chestnut Hill won the next three matches to take a 5-1 lead with
Joao Sousa defeating Ross at #3 singles, 6-3, 6-4 and Vicente defeating Ladhani 6-4, 6-4 at#4 singles.Â
Siddharth Malik won at #5 singles, 6-3, 6-4 over Bruno. The Chargers scored their remaining point with a win at #6 singles.
The Griffins' quest for the conference championship begins with their semi final match vs. Post next Tuesday, with the winner facing defensing champion Jefferson on Friday at the CHC Tennis Courts.
